III Sectoral Dialogue Between Mozambique and the European Union in the fields of Economy, trade and investment.

The 3rd Sectoral Dialogue on Economy, Trade and Investment took place in Nampula, in the Municipality of Ilha de Moçambique. It is an operational mechanism for monitoring strategic actions essential for boosting and increasing trade between Mozambique and the European Union.

The 3rd Mozambique – European Union Sector Dialogue addressed, in detail, the implementation of the current EU-SADC Economic Partnership Agreement, Trade and Investment Facilitation, improving the business environment and the competitiveness of micro, small and medium-sized companies for facilitate their inclusion in European investment chains, the follow-up of support opportunities and projects announced during the Mozambique – EU “Global Gateway” Investment Forum, which took place in November 2023.

On the sidelines of the event, a Mozambique – European Union Business and Investment Round Table was held, dedicated to the private sector of both parties.

For Silvino Moreno, Minister of Industry and Commerce, it is strategically important to continue in a consolidated manner with the Dialogue model in the provinces, always associated with the Business and Investment Round Table, as a mutual commitment to strengthening the commercial relationship, publicizing the potential of the local private sector and capitalization of existing opportunities under the Economic Partnership Agreement.

The event began with a field activity, with a visit to the Port of Nacala and some strategic enterprises established in the Special Economic Zone, in addition to projects, companies and institutions that are part of the ecosystem that also contributes to boosting economic cooperation between Mozambique and the European Union.

According to ANTONINO MAGGIORE, Ambassador of the European Union in Mozambique, the Dialogue served to review the state of joint trade, and the preferential agreement that offers many opportunities to deepen our trade relations, which is the SADC-EU Economic Partnership Agreement (EPA). . “We need to reflect on how we can make better use of the EPA, exploring its full potential, not only to increase trade between Mozambique and the EU, but also within the region and within the continent, this also in support of the Trade Agreement Free African Continental” Said!

The event, which took place under the motto “Promoting the Facilitation of Trade, Investment and Economic Partnership” was led by His Excellency SILVINO AUGUSTO JOSÉ MORENO, Minister of Industry and Commerce, representing the Government of Mozambique, accompanied by the respective delegation, and His Excellency ANTONINO MAGGIORE, Ambassador of the European Union in Mozambique, accompanied by Ambassadors, Chargé d’Affaires and Representatives of the Member States of the European Union present in Mozambique.

Also participating are His Excellency JAIME BESSA AUGUSTO NETO, Secretary of State, and His Excellency MANUEL RODRIGUES, Governor of the Province of Nampula.
